Is there any code or requirement for voltage, ACI rating, physical size of gear, or whatever that would call for at least a fenced in, lockable, dedicated electrical gear area where unauthorized personnel could not get access? If so, at what point should the line be drawn between needing and not needing this area?

AFAIK NEC mostly only requires some kind of barrier to keep unauthorized persons away from equipment with exposed live components. This is also something not really seen much if at all in 600 volts or less equipment.

Now other codes or safety standards (like 70E) may require more than NEC does in some cases.
